Why Camper Van Bed Slats Fail and How to Prevent It

Standard domestic beds only deal with static downward force, but a camper van bed suffers from constant multi-directional forces. Road vibrations slowly back out standard wood screws, while highway potholes multiply the effective weight of the sleepers instantly. Over time, these dynamic forces widen screw holes, warp thin wood, and cause joints to shear.

Moisture accumulation is another major culprit behind bed platform failure. Without proper airflow underneath, body heat and sweat create condensation under the mattress, leading to wood rot, mold, and eventual structural degradation of raw timber slats. Preventing this requires using moisture-resistant materials, applying protective finishes, and ensuring adequate ventilation gaps.

Finally, structural shifting occurs when the van chassis flexes during travel. Unlike a concrete house foundation, a van wall twists slightly when driving over uneven terrain or off-road campsites. Rigidly fixing bed slats without allowing for this minor chassis twist will eventually crack the support rails or tear mounting brackets out of the van sheet metal.

Key Factors for Choosing Van Bed Support Materials

When selecting materials for a mobile bed frame, the strength-to-weight ratio is your primary constraint. Every pound added to the bed frame reduces the van’s cargo capacity and fuel efficiency, meaning heavy dimensional lumber like standard 2x4s is rarely the smartest choice. Instead, engineered wood, lightweight metals, and strategic bracing provide maximum rigidity without bloat.

Environmental resilience is equally critical for off-grid durability. Vans experience extreme temperature swings and high humidity, making untreated pine slats prone to warping and bowing. Choosing materials like high-grade birch plywood, anodized aluminum, and corrosion-resistant fasteners ensures the structure remains true over years of seasonal exposure.

Vibration dampening properties must also guide your choices. Hard metal-on-metal or wood-on-wood contact points will inevitably generate maddening squeaks on the road. Successful builders select materials that can be easily isolated with webbing, rubber, or adhesive to absorb structural noise before it drives you crazy.

How to Eliminate Squeaks and Rattles in Van Beds

A squeaky bed frame might be tolerable in a static home, but in a camper van, a loose joint will rattle relentlessly with every turn of the steering wheel. To eliminate noise, you must prevent direct wood-on-wood and wood-on-metal contact. Applying adhesive-backed felt tape or thin neoprene stripping along the ledger rail before dropping the slats in place creates a highly effective acoustic barrier.

Additionally, always use a high-quality flexible construction adhesive in tandem with your mechanical fasteners during the initial build. Fasteners hold the joints tight, but the adhesive fills the microscopic voids where friction-induced squeaks originate. If you must use metal brackets, ensure they are tightly secured with star-drive screws that won’t back out under vibration.

For sliding or convertible bed platforms, look for contact points that rub during transition. Applying dry PTFE lubricant or installing ultra-high-molecular-weight (UHMW) plastic tape along sliding tracks will keep the mechanism quiet while protecting the contact surfaces from wear.

Sizing and Spacing Rules for Maximum Weight Capacity

Achieving maximum weight capacity on a van bed requires strict adherence to sizing and spacing rules. For standard wooden slats, a thickness of at least 0.75 inches is required to prevent sagging under two adults. Slat spacing should never exceed 3 inches; wider gaps fail to support the mattress properly and can void your mattress warranty.

The unsupported span of each slat also plays a critical role in weight distribution. If your bed platform spans more than 48 inches across the van, you must introduce a center support rail to prevent the slats from bowing. Splitting a 60-inch Queen bed into two shorter 30-inch spans with a center rail dramatically increases the overall weight capacity of the system.

When anchoring support ledges to the van walls, place your primary fasteners every 12 to 16 inches into structural metal ribs. Using structural rivets or heavy-duty self-tapping screws ensures that the shear load of the sleepers is safely transferred directly to the van’s chassis, rather than relying on weak plywood wall panels.
